Comprehending Silk Testing: A Classic Printing Strategy

Silk testing, additionally called screen printing, is a functional and widely-used printing technique that dates back centuries. Originally established in ancient China, this technique involves utilizing a stencil to apply ink onto numerous materials, generating vibrant and thorough photos. Today, silk screening is an essential procedure in the fabric, advertising and marketing, and art markets, valued for its capability to produce top notch prints with precision and sturdiness.

The basic principle of silk screening relies on a mesh display, generally made from polyester or nylon, which serves as the medium for transferring ink. A stencil is produced on the display, shutting out locations where ink must not get to the substratum. The printer after that presses ink across the display with a squeegee, requiring it via the open locations of the stencil and onto the underlying product, such as fabric, paper, and even plastic. This procedure permits complex designs and vibrant colors, making it a preferred choice for custom-made garments and advertising items.

One of the significant advantages of silk testing is its scalability for both small and big production runs. When a stencil is produced, several duplicates of the style can be printed quickly, decreasing expenses for mass orders. In addition, silk testing provides exceptional color vibrancy and opacity, enabling the application of brilliant, bold colors that stand apart. This makes it an outstanding option for fabrics utilized in advertising and marketing campaigns, product, or imaginative endeavors where visual charm is vital.

In spite of its several benefits, silk testing does include some disadvantages. The first setup costs, consisting of the development of stencils and screens, can be reasonably high, making it much less suitable for tiny, one-off jobs. Additionally, the method is best for designs with restricted colors since each color needs a separate stencil. However, with advancements in technology, there are now approaches that expedite the process and broaden creative possibilities, including electronic silk testing and crossbreed methods that combine different printing techniques.

To conclude, silk testing remains a preferred option for musicians, designers, and marketers due to its one-of-a-kind capacity to create top notch, resilient prints with lively shades. As a time-honored method that remains to evolve, it connects the void in between conventional workmanship and contemporary development. Whether you’re seeking to brand name your company or create a spectacular art piece, comprehending silk screening can open new methods for creative expression and business chance.

Coordinate Measuring Machine Service Boosts Manufacturing Productivity

The manufacturing sector has evolved significantly over the years, driven by the need for precision, quality, and efficiency. One of the key factors contributing to this evolution is the use of advanced technologies, including Coordinate Measuring Machines, or CMMs. A CMM service plays a vital role in ensuring that these machines function optimally, thereby boosting manufacturing productivity. When you invest in a CMM service, you can expect a range of benefits that impact your bottom line positively.

The Role of CMMs in Manufacturing
CMMs are sophisticated devices used to measure the geometry of physical objects. They are widely used in various manufacturing industries, including aerospace, automotive, and medical devices. These machines use a probe to touch the object being measured, and the resulting data is used to create a detailed map of the object’s surface. This information is crucial in ensuring that the object meets the required specifications and quality standards. By using a CMM, manufacturers can detect defects and irregularities early in the production process, reducing waste and improving overall quality.

Preventive Maintenance is Key
To ensure that your CMM operates at peak performance, regular maintenance is essential. A reputable CMM service provider will offer preventive maintenance programs tailored to your specific needs. These programs typically include routine cleaning, calibration, and inspection of the machine. By identifying potential issues before they become major problems, you can minimize downtime and reduce the risk of costly repairs. Preventive maintenance also helps extend the lifespan of your CMM, ensuring that you get the most out of your investment.

Calibration and Repair Services
A CMM service also offers calibration and repair services, which are critical to maintaining the accuracy and reliability of your machine. Calibration involves adjusting the CMM’s parameters to ensure that it meets the required standards. This process is typically performed using certified artifacts and trained technicians. If your CMM is not calibrated correctly, it can lead to inaccurate measurements, which can have serious consequences in terms of product quality and safety. In the event of a breakdown, a CMM service provider can repair your machine quickly and efficiently, minimizing downtime and getting you back to production as soon as possible.

“Shifting the Landscape: The Intricate Process of Maine Building Movers”

As you drive through the picturesque towns and cities of Maine, you may have noticed structures that seem to defy gravity, suspended mid-air or perched precariously on the side of a hill. These are not optical illusions, but rather the result of the meticulous work of Maine building movers. These skilled professionals have mastered the art of relocating buildings, bridges, and other structures to new locations, often in the most challenging and inaccessible areas.

The process of building relocation is a complex and labor-intensive one, requiring careful planning, precision engineering, and a deep understanding of the structure’s underlying architecture. Maine building movers must first assess the condition of the building, taking into account factors such as its weight, size, and material composition. They must also consider the terrain and environmental conditions of the new location, as well as any potential obstacles or hazards that may arise during the relocation process.

Once the assessment is complete, the building movers will develop a detailed plan of action, including the selection of the most suitable equipment and personnel for the job. This may involve the use of specialized cranes, dollies, and other machinery, as well as a team of experienced workers who have honed their skills through years of practice.

One of the most critical aspects of building relocation is the preparation of the site itself. This involves clearing the area of any debris or obstructions, as well as installing a sturdy foundation or anchoring system to ensure the structure’s stability during the relocation process. The building movers must also take steps to protect the surrounding environment, including the installation of temporary barriers and the use of specialized equipment to minimize disruption to nearby buildings and infrastructure.

As the relocation process begins, the building movers will carefully lift the structure off its foundation and transport it to its new location. This may involve a combination of manual labor and mechanical assistance, as well as a high degree of precision and control to ensure the structure’s stability and safety.

Once the building has been relocated, the building movers will begin the process of reassembly and reconstruction. This may involve the installation of new foundations, the repair of any damage sustained during the relocation process, and the completion of any necessary finishing work.
